US Airdate: 19/11/2020 (CBS All Access)
International: 20/11/2020 (Netflix)
This thread is for the pre and post discussion of the Season 3 episode "Scavengers" - this will be a spoiler filled discussion so if you've found your way past the warnings in the activity stream and the spoiler tag on the thread, this is your last chance to turn back, or at least it will be at the end of this first post. You have been warned!
Having reunited with the Federation and Starfleet, Discovery begins the process of adapting to their new situation. After receiving a message from Booker, Burnham and Georgiou depart on a rogue mission to reach him. Meanwhile, Stamets forms an unexpected bond with Adira.
Some promo shots of the upcoming episode can be found here. This episode marks the reappearance of David Ajala as Booker and features Ian Alexander as Gray.
"Scavengers" is episode 6 of 13.
Written by: Anne Cofell Saunders
Directed by: Doug Aarniokoski

but does this mean there has not been another USS Discovery in 930 years?
There's a reference to a USS Discovery during the early days of TNG, though I don't think it's mentioned in dialogue and just appears on an Okudagram. It would seem that they've leaned on the assumed lore slightly and the letter is attached to the registry itself rather than the actual name. That more or less makes sense however since multiple ships of different registries have had the same name, like the Prometheus, Intrepid and Farragut.
In terms of hard canon, there's now a total of 4 ships that retained their registry:
Enterprise - NCC-1701-E
Relativity - NCV-474439-G
Voyager - NCC-74656-J
Discovery - NCC-1031-A
The Defiant wasn't the first ship to bear the name and was supposed to have picked up the A suffix when it was replaced by the Sao Paulo, but as they didn't redo the graphics for the final episode exterior scenes, effectively it didn't count unless that gets retconned somewhere down the line.

From the previous episode ("Die Trying"), USS Tikhov also retained her registry (NCC-1067-M); it was shown on the screen Tilly had up while she was talking to Burnham. MA has the info: https://memory-alpha.fandom.com/wiki/USS_Tikhov
As for the -A on Discovery, there's a theory on another Trek fan group I'm a member of that Starfleet added the letter to the registry to hide the fact that they had a clear violation of the Temporal Accords so they could take advantage of the spore drive, and all the cosmetic changes give ample cover, to make it look as though they resurrected another long-standing name as they had with the other names (Voyager, Enterprise, etc).

I'm not saying it's the sole reason, just a significant motivator along with all the cosmetic and practical chances made in the upgrades. From a historical perspective (sorry my US History minor is going to show here): Traditionally, an HCN doesn't change even if you refit a ship into a new class. Obviously, Starfleet may go a different way in terms of the lettering, but historically the complete designation is part of the HCN. It's scifi, Starfleet's gonna Starfleet.
I always held it as head canon that the only ship to receive the lettering honor was Enterprise because of her legendary exploits. Previously, Starfleet had renumbered the other ships of fame from the Constitution-class that had also survived their five year missions. And I could definitely see Voyager getting that honor as she was the first ship to survive being flung 70kly from home and returned mostly safe.
